Hello AK Nirala,
You gave got a percentile of 70.6. and you belong to OBC-NCL. Right? I am afraid that your percentile is lower than the cutoff percentile of 74.31. announced by JoSAA for eligibility of registration on their portal. In view of this you will not be allowed to register and hence can not seek admission in any NIT.
